Abstract

The invention belongs to the technical field of flexible displayers and particularly relates to a writing or erasing method for a flexible reflection type cholesteric liquid crystal displayer. The writing or erasing method for the flexible reflection type cholesteric liquid crystal displayer comprises the following steps that a cholesteric liquid crystal mixture is injected into a liquid crystal cell, wherein the cholesteric liquid crystal mixture contains chiral compounds, and the mass fraction of the chiral compounds is 10%; voltage is applied to the cholesteric liquid crystal mixture so that the cholesteric liquid crystal mixture can be in a focal state (3), wherein the voltage applied to the cholesteric liquid crystal mixture is larger than the threshold voltage at which the planar texture of the cholesteric liquid crystal mixture can be transformed to the focal texture and is smaller than the breakdown voltage of the cholesteric liquid crystal mixture; cholesteric liquid crystal is made to be in the focal state (3) or the planar state (4) by controlling the temperature and the voltage, and thus writing or erasing is achieved, wherein the voltage is controlled to change in a waved mode. According to the writing or erasing method for the flexible reflection type cholesteric liquid crystal displayer, when the focal texture of the cholesteric liquid crystal is converted into the planar texture or the planar texture of the cholesteric liquid crystal is converted into the focal texture, the response time is shortened by 20% compared with the prior art, and the brightness is greatly improved.

Background technology
Society development in science and technology is maked rapid progress, and electronic information series products and our life are closely bound up.From mobile phone, computer to domestic TV, wrist-watch screen etc., liquid crystal is with irresistible mighty torrent development, and its range of application is also in constantly development, and function is also more perfect.
Flexible display technologies is the inexorable trend of current display development, and the technique of preparing flexible panel also has a great development.Flexible base, board has the feature of mechanical flexibility and high density interconnect, now adopts flexible base, board to realize the also more and more of encapsulating structure.With respect to traditional display technique, as glass substrate, flexible display technologies has the features such as quality is light, ultra-thin, easy to carry, cost is low, is the main development direction of following display, thus its grind make internal disorder or usurp significant.
Cholesteric liquid crystal has the feature of high brightness, high-contrast, low energy consumption.It has unique bistable characteristic, and in voltage-controlled situation, can keep not needing, and this specific character can be controlled trichromatic gray scale.Flexible reflective cholesteric liquid crystal applications according to himself pitch only to giving and reflection with the light of the identical wavelength of its length, and the light transmission of other wavelength.
The writing or wiping of cholesteric liquid crystal displays in prior art is to use simple heating or apply voltage to make cholesteric liquid crystal bore state by Jiao to convert plane state to, make its reflection speed voltage request lower, duty higher.The patent No. is 200510086631.0 Chinese patent, it discloses a kind of wiping or wiring method cholesteric liquid crystal stored information, the method is to have used a kind of helically twisted power to be mixed into cholesteric liquid crystal with temperature chipal compounds and the nematic liquid crystal reducing that raise, and the massfraction of chipal compounds is 0.1-20%.The method can be unfavorable with power plant, magnetic field, do not use negative liquid crystal or double frequency to drive in the situation of liquid crystal, realize cholesteric liquid crystal and change planar texture with speed faster into by focal conic texture.It is fast not enough that but the method makes cholesteric liquid crystal change planar texture speed into by focal conic texture, can not meet current demand.
Summary of the invention
In order to overcome the deficiencies in the prior art, the present invention utilize pitch variation with temperature and change, temperature variation causes pitch to change, catoptrical frequency also changes, presents the principle of the variation of color, the display mode that provides a kind of heat to write or wipe.In the present invention, the heat temperature control that writes or wipe simultaneously, applies and presents the voltage that certain ripple formula changes, and in the time that focal conic texture and the planar texture of cholesteric liquid crystal are changed mutually, its response time improves 20% than the time of the prior art, controls conveniently, reduces costs.
Writing or a method for deleting of flexible reflective cholesteric phase liquid crystal display, it comprises the steps:
(1) cholesteric liquid crystal potpourri is injected in liquid crystal cell, in described cholesteric liquid crystal potpourri, contains massfraction and be 10% chipal compounds;
(2) apply voltage to cholesteric liquid crystal potpourri, make cholesteric liquid crystal potpourri bore state in Jiao; Threshold voltage that the planar texture that the described voltage applying is greater than cholesteric liquid crystal potpourri changes to focal conic texture, be less than the voltage breakdown of cholesteric liquid crystal potpourri;
(3) make cholesteric liquid crystal bore state or plane state in Jiao by controlling temperature and voltage, realize and write or wipe; Described control voltage is to make voltage present the voltage that ripple formula changes.
Such scheme preferably, is write fashionablely without information, cholesteric liquid crystal is in planar texture; Need information to write fashionable, the region that will write is heated with hot mode, apply simultaneously and be the voltage that ripple formula changes, after in the time stopping heating, temperature is down to room temperature immediately, cholesteric liquid crystal becomes burnt cone state, realizes heat and writes.
Above-mentioned arbitrary scheme preferably, needs information to write fashionable, and the temperature that the region that write is heated is 55-70 DEG C.
More preferably, need information to write fashionable, the temperature that the region that write is heated is 60 DEG C.
Above-mentioned arbitrary scheme preferably, need to wipe time, heat by the region that needs are wiped, and makes liquid crystal bore state from Jiao and become plane state, and realization is wiped; Or the region of directly wiping at needs applies voltage, make liquid crystal be converted into burnt cone state by plane state, realization is wiped.
Preferably, need to wipe time, the temperature that heat in the region that needs are wiped is 85-100 DEG C to above-mentioned arbitrary scheme.
More preferably, need to wipe time, the temperature that heat in the region that needs are wiped is 90 DEG C.
Preferably, need to wipe time, the magnitude of voltage that the region of wiping at needs applies is 10-15V to above-mentioned arbitrary scheme.
Preferably, described liquid crystal cell top and bottom are the flexible pet substrates that scribble transparent conductive film to above-mentioned arbitrary scheme.
Preferably, described transparent conductive film is ITO electrode to above-mentioned arbitrary scheme, on described ITO electrode, is added with grid template, and it is fixed that described grid template is carried out UV-curing after injecting curing materials, forms cholesteric liquid crystal potpourri and stores grid.When heat in the region that needs are write or wiped, be that the flexible base, board of cholesteric liquid crystal potpourri storage grid both sides is heated.
Preferably, what described cholesteric liquid crystal potpourri stored grid is shaped as square, triangle or circle to above-mentioned arbitrary scheme.
Preferably, described ITO electrode is connected with heat conduction and/or electric installation above-mentioned arbitrary scheme.
Preferably, flexible pet substrate is connected with the reflectance coating of cholesteric phase corresponding wavelength above-mentioned arbitrary scheme below described liquid crystal cell.
Preferably, described in step (3), control temperature is to heat by thermal probe to above-mentioned arbitrary scheme; Described thermal probe heating voltage is 7.2v direct current, and resolution is 500dpi, heat time 40s.
Preferably, described in step (3), control temperature is directly to heat with laser pulse to above-mentioned arbitrary scheme, and the heat time is 40s.
Preferably, the voltage that described ripple formula changes is to be square wave formula to change to above-mentioned arbitrary scheme.
Preferably, the voltage that described ripple formula changes is to be sine wave type to change to above-mentioned arbitrary scheme.
Preferably, the voltage that described ripple formula changes is to be sawtooth wave formula to change to above-mentioned arbitrary scheme.
Above-mentioned arbitrary scheme preferably, while cholesteric liquid crystal potpourri being injected in liquid crystal cell described in step (1), is to carry out under vacuum condition.Can avoid like this generation of bubble.
Writing or erasing apparatus system of a kind of flexible reflective cholesteric phase liquid crystal display, comprise liquid crystal display, it is characterized in that, also comprise: cholesteric liquid crystal potpourri is injected into the device in liquid crystal cell, in described cholesteric liquid crystal potpourri, contains massfraction and be 10% chipal compounds; Execute alive voltage device to cholesteric liquid crystal potpourri, described voltage makes cholesteric liquid crystal potpourri bore state in Jiao; Threshold voltage that the planar texture that described voltage is greater than cholesteric liquid crystal potpourri changes to focal conic texture, be less than the voltage breakdown of cholesteric liquid crystal potpourri; Control the temperature device of cholesteric liquid crystal mixture temperature; Make cholesteric liquid crystal bore state or plane state in Jiao by described voltage device and temperature device, realize and write or wipe; Described voltage is to make voltage present the voltage that ripple formula changes.In the present invention, while being planar texture, being plane state, is burnt cone state while being focal conic texture.
Utilize writing or method for deleting of flexible reflective cholesteric phase liquid crystal display of the present invention, can make the reflectivity of cholesteric liquid crystal can reach 87%, its brightness is greatly improved; The present invention is that different ripple formula variations is heated by controlling voltage, and corresponding variation can occur the reflectivity of cholesteric liquid crystal, changes GTG by such mode, can realize heat and write or wipe; Utilize writing or erase mode of the complete thermal control of the present invention, can make the response speed of cholesteric liquid crystal improve 20%, improve the quality of image; Voltage when work is less than the 20-25% of prior art.
